Ok OP, What model is your car? GX/GXE? Is it a Manual?

Ok you want > either an XF Throttlebody (68mm) or a KA24e (60mm) The latter is a direct bolt on but is obviously smaller, getting it enlarged to about ~ 64mm would be good, no use going any more as the AFM is only 63.5mm. There is a Guide on fitting the XF throttlebody at R31skylineclub.com, you also need to bore out your plenum, to match the throttlebody's.

Add a 3" intake, heatwrap it, give it a good pod and a good heatproof enclosure, with some cold air feeds - unlike later model skylines this does actually make a big difference if its done properly.

Another thing that gives just a bee's dick more power is (carefully) grinding off the heatsink inside the afm and taking off the mesh, just for less restriction and more flow.

Run 98Ron fuel and advance the timing to 20degrees (if you dont do the next step) or around that, lower it if you hear pinging.

Get a Darkhalf tuned ECU [cheap] they are the best, dont get ebay shit OR get a custom dyno tune (if you can afford it)

Get a good set of extractors, if you want performance, go a good brand, like Geni/pacemakers etc, get a 2.1/4" or 2.5" MANDREL bent exhaust and a "highflow" CAT of somesort.

Change the Diff gear ratio, from the stock 3.7 to maybe 3.9 (best compromise) or a pinny geared 4.1 if you dont mind high revving on the highway, and get an LSD for better takeoffs

Lightened flywheel, singlepeice tailshaft, lighter rims, good grip tires, weight reduction...

Suspension/handling mods to make the car funner ,and get better brakes.

if you want to go internals, raise the compression to a nice ~ 10-10.5:1, maybe a P&P job if you can justify it, Maybe a Mild Cam - but if you intend to keep the car and want to go turbo later on, i would hold off...

and of course theres always the old RB25 head on 30 block trick

goodluck

I was going to add timing to the list but slip beat me to it :wave:

..and to all the people who have said "cams"... it's an RB30E, it only has one cam, singular :sick:

..also with the cam, if you want anything more than a mild grind, you'll need to get the lifter housings machined, and buy a new set of lifters.

anyway my intention isnt to get into an argument over this, but what you were saying is that a 20de is faster, this is not the case, a good 30e with those mods will walk away from a RB25de with the same gearing, you cant beat torque.

alo people, dont forget your not talking about a newer engine, its not like the 20de and the 25de's etc which have been setup perfect from factory, to the point where most mods do SFA, with the rb30 simple things like exhaust and intake give it HEAPS as it is so restrictive from factory.

example, a stock 30e gets around ~ 85rwkw? give it a 3" intake, bigger throttlebody, pod filter, extractors and high flowing exhaust and you can pull about 105-110rwkw on average, that is a very decent increase.

also remember its not about peak kw, like yeah a 20de might pull 110rwkw too, but where? at 7500rpm? yay... below that its got nothing and no toque, remember kids, power outputs sell cars, torque and good power curves win races.

30e's dont rev and tend not to make a very high peak power, but they keep high power and torque through the revs which is where the difference is.

sandyb - my 31 had koni/whiteline suspension all round, swaybars, strut brace, strut tops, etc etc, and a custom R32 GTSt brake setup front and rear. With the RB30E it was fun. I could give it full bikkies all the time, corner on the limit and play with it, it was a driving car.

add a 233rwkw RB25DET that comes on very hard at 4-4500rpm, and try to exit a 2nd gear corner hard, and things get very tricky. Revs have to be right, and if they are, you have to be very careful about feeding the power on. if the revs arent right, it just does nothing then goes berko when boost comes on. not fun, not easy. Great for straight line stuff and torching the rears, but not as a mountain/time trial car, which was my scene.

do the basic cheap mods to the RB30E, have some fun, concentrate on brakes/suspension because my god they need it. i didnt spend any money on more hp for the first 4 years, but was always quickest in the time trials at mt cotton vs 33 GTS-t's etc - power isnt everything.
